COMPANY OVERVIEW

Tramview Capital Management is a value-oriented real estate investment management firm focused on investing in institutional quality real estate in targeted growth markets across the U.S. TCM was formed in 2020 by Rob Davies and Zach Segal, who have collectively overseen and managed approximately $5 billion of equity invested globally across the multifamily, industrial, office, and other real estate sectors. TCM is focused on generating strong, risk-adjusted returns by investing in properties at an attractive and defensible basis in targeted markets and in sectors with compelling long-term fundamentals and proven liquidity. TCM seeks to acquire well-located properties that have multiple levers to enhance income through value-add initiatives.

PRIMARY RESPONSIBILITIES

  • General: Work closely with investment team members and related third-party providers including the fund administrator to manage the daily financial and operational functions of an entrepreneurial and growing real estate private equity investment management company.
  • Management Company: Oversee books and records, budgeting, third party contract negotiation and renewal, insurance regime, policies and procedures manual, federal and state tax compliance, federal and state registration compliance, HR function, entity structuring, bank accounts and funding, office expansion requirements, and IT.
  • Fund: Manage quarterly reporting, annual fund audit, tax compliance and structuring, fund LPA amendments and legal compliance, policies and procedures manual, third party contract negotiation and renewal, insurance program regime, subscription facility structuring and compliance, federal and state registration compliance, bank accounts and funding, entity structuring, capital calls and distributions, limited partner transfers, and fund investor closings.
